PPMF for Android = Kripto Video Protector (on windows)

PPMF for Android (password protects media files)

PPMF for Android = (Kripto Video Protector on windows)

PPMF for Android is a privacy application that protects media files (video, audio, and image files) with a password and plays/shows them on the fly like normal media files. It leaves no trace (decryption is done on the fly, in memory, and creates no disk cache, no temp files)

PPMF & PPIF files can be created and played on Windows and Mobile devices (currently Android only).

With this application, you can preview PPMF & PPIF files just like regular files in a folder with thumbnails, rating, file names, media information and so on.

You can add/edit keywords, change poster image, thumbnails, search by keyword, sort by rating, by file name, by media type, etc.

DOWNLOAD

Privacy Policy

You can use this application without worrying about your privacy. Maximizing your privacy is one of the main purposes of this application.

For maximum possible privacy:

  • This application does NOT collect or store any of your data in any way.
  • Cache files are encrypted and stored in the AppData folder with the password of the associated PPMF files. Cache files cannot be opened without knowing the password of the associated PPMF files.
  • This application does NOT track bugs or your use of the application in any way.
  • This application does NOT connect to the Internet except to check for license key revocation ONLY DURING activation.
  • Activation code of this application is universal and anonymous. It can be used on any device that runs this application.
  • Enjoy it. Don't forget to support me for your privacy :)

Features

  • List, play, preview, search, sort PPMF and PPIF files: PPMF & PPIF files can be listed with their poster images as if they were a folder full of images with thumbnail previews. Double-click/tap poster image to open/play media file on the fly.
  • Encrypt Media: Protect media files (Video, Audio, and image files) with a password.
  • Decrypt Media: Decrypt (extract) original media files from PPMF & PPIF files without any data loss.
  • Password changer: Change password of PPMF & PPIF files, or create a copy of them with a different password.
  • Auto exit: PPMF application can auto-close when it goes to background, when device is in sleep mode, or when sleep button is pressed, or Device idle time longer than user-defined auto-close timeout
  • No screenshot: By default, screenshot, screen mirroring, casting, etc. of this application is disabled. To enable screen mirroring, you must disable this feature in the settings each time you start the application.
  • Video can be zoomed in and out like an image
  • Custom keyboard More than 200 built-in keyboards. Regular keyboards keep track of what you type. Using custom keybords is more privacy friendly when entering passwords or searching for keywords.
  • Watch the sample usage videos below

PPMF and PPIF files

PPMF (Password Protected Media file): It is an encrypted video or audio file with additional information such as thumbnails, tags, keywords, media information, etc.

Supports all popular video and audio files (e.g. mp3, m4a, flac, mp4, webm, mkv, avi, wmv, flv...)

AES-256 is used to encrypt the data. Default key derivations are RFC2898 50000, BCrypt 1667, and Argon 2id (64 MB mem. thread 4).

Argon and BCrypt iterations depend on the RFC2898 iteration count and the PIN provided by the user.

User can increase number of iterations by defining PIN (Password iteration number) when encrypting media files.

PIN + password makes the password very strong

PPIF (Password Protected Image file): It is an encrypted image file (jpg, png, webp, heic, heif ...) with additional information e.g. thumbnails, tags, keywords, media information, etc.

Screenshots

Sample usage videos

NOTE: The sound quality of the videos below is poor because they were recorded using the tablet microphone, not from the original sound.

PPMF.Android (v1.5.0.0) = Kripto Video Protector (on windows)

DOWNLOAD for Android (APK)

SHA256:e1195100f80dc70a3c2843c13551db74c648a7225e49a8bc26368692db46c6b8

DOWNLOAD for windows

SUPPORT/BUY ($1/month on Patreon)

PLATFORMS: Android 14, 13, 12, 11, 10, 9

NOTES

  • This app can be activated Universal license code of Kripto Video Protector
  • This application can work without an internet connection. You only need a one-time Internet connection to activate it.

Please send your suggestions, questions, bug reports etc. to

Known issues & situations

  • By default, screen capture, screen mirroring, casting, etc. are disabled for this application. In order to enable screen mirroring, casting, you will need to enable this feature in the settings every time you start the application. (intentionally we do not save value of this setting)
  • Auto exit feature: False by default. The application closes automatically when it goes to the background, when the device is in sleep mode, or when the sleep button is used if the password cache is not empty. So you might think the app has crashed if you switch to another app and try to switch back to the PPMF app (it is closed). This is normal behaviour if the Auto Exit feature is enabled and the password cache is not empty.
  • Google Play Store does not allow third-party payments, donations, etc. So I need to create another version of this app that uses the Google Paymanet system API to publish it to the Google Play Store.

Please send your suggestions, questions, bug reports etc. to

PPMF (Kripto Video Protector) for other platforms

Home | Contact | Privacy Policy